A woman in central China used a rice cooker as an incubator to hatch chicken eggs.

Video filmed in the city of Yichang in Hubei Province on April 24 shows a woman named Li using a rice cooker and a temperature controller to make an incubator to hatch 30 eggs.

After 21 days, 21 out of 30 chicken eggs successfully hatched.

Li said to Hubei Television that her friends also brought eggs to her to ask her to help hatch them after her successful batch of hatches.
